Let me start a list of why not to work for this horrible place:
1. Extra flying forms, forget to fill one out and you will not get paid for what you worked. Fill one out correctly and in certain situations, you will still not get paid for what you deserve because crew scheduling (who does payroll) doesnt think you should.
2. Opens and closes based with, oh, about 10 DAYS notice, on average... Springfield, Ft. Lauderdale, Boise... eventually Boston.
3. Proposing a captain pay cut of $5/hour after what was negotiated ~7 years ago. Doesn't pay usually increase atleast 3% per year on average? Instead of the 37/hr. wage 7 years ago that should be more that $43/hr. now, management is proposing $30/hr. now... just because Mesa does it doesn't mean it is the right thing to do!
4. Crews being put up in hotels in Canada, being kicked out at 1300 when their crew call isn't until 1800. This kind of nonsense is uncalled for!
5. Needing a cab ride to the airport because the hotel shuttle doesn't run at the time your flight is departing in the middle of the night because of crappy airline management... none of THREE credit card #'s work!!! Every single one DENIED! No, I am not paying my own money to get to the airport that I will not get back!!!
6. You have a reserve schedule and think you'll have 10 days off next month... forget that, you'll be flown into DAY B (your day off) every chance scheduling gets!
7. Want to go to training on a ticket purchased by BS air... forget that, most have to jumpseat because the one Skywest and one United STANDBY ticket the company gets you (AT EXTREMELY MINIMAL COST) will very rarely get you there! You will be flying standby to get to required training, and yes, it is your fault and it will be held against YOU if you don't get there on time... even if it is Christmas time and the flights are overbooked by 20 5 days in advance.
8. No CASS, which was ABSOLUTELY promised by June 1st... but that doesn't bother management, so they'll take their sweet time!
